Understanding the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ern Design
A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ern typically centers around a lion motif that can be created using appliquΓ©, piecing, or foundation paper piecing techniques. Each method offers a distinct aesthetic. AppliquΓ© allows for smooth curves and expressive facial details, while piecing techniques create a more geometric and modern look. Choosing the right technique depends on your comfort level and the visual outcome you desire.
Color selection plays a crucial role in the success of a Lion Quilt. Warm tones such as golden yellows, deep browns, and burnt oranges often reflect the natural colors of a lionβs mane. However, modern interpretations may use unexpected palettes like blues, greys, or even rainbow gradients for a playful twist. The versatility of the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ern makes it adaptable to both traditional and contemporary dΓ©cor styles.
Scale is another important design factor. A large central lion block creates a bold statement piece, while smaller repeated lion motifs can form a patterned quilt top with rhythmic visual flow. Understanding proportion ensures that your Lion Quilt maintains balance and harmony throughout the layout.
Fabric choice impacts both durability and visual texture. High-quality cotton fabrics are commonly used for a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ern, as they are easy to sew and hold shape well over time. Blending solid fabrics with subtle prints can add depth without overwhelming the lion design.
Quilting techniques such as free-motion stitching can enhance the lionβs mane, adding dimension and movement. Strategic stitching lines can mimic the texture of fur, making the Lion Quilt feel more dynamic and lifelike.
Finally, incorporating borders and sashing can frame the lion design beautifully. Borders in complementary colors help anchor the composition and give the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ern a polished, professional finish.
Materials and Preparation for a Successful Lion Quilt
Before beginning your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ern, proper preparation is essential. Start by gathering all necessary materials, including fabric, batting, thread, rotary cutter, cutting mat, and quilting ruler. Organized preparation reduces mistakes and ensures a smoother sewing process.
Choosing high-quality thread is just as important as selecting fabric. Strong, durable thread ensures that your Lion Quilt withstands regular use and washing without unraveling. Neutral thread colors often work best, but decorative stitching can incorporate contrasting shades for artistic effect.
Batting selection influences the final texture and warmth of your quilt. Cotton batting provides a soft, breathable finish, while polyester blends can add loft and extra insulation. The right batting enhances the comfort and structure of the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ern.
Accurate cutting is crucial in quilting. Even minor measurement errors can affect alignment, especially when working with detailed lion facial features. Using sharp tools and double-checking measurements ensures that each piece of your Lion Quilt fits perfectly.
Pressing seams properly throughout the process creates crisp lines and a flat quilt top. Taking time to press each seam as you go improves the overall quality of your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ern and makes the final quilting stage much easier.
Creating a test block before assembling the entire quilt can help you identify potential issues. This small step allows you to refine techniques and confirm color placement before committing to the full Lion Quilt layout.

Tips for Sewing, Quilting, and Finishing
Patience is key when assembling a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ern. Taking time with each seam and alignment ensures the lionβs facial features remain symmetrical and expressive. Rushing through detailed sections can compromise the final result.
When layering the quilt sandwich, smooth out wrinkles carefully to avoid puckering during quilting. A well-prepared base enhances the durability and appearance of your finished Lion Quilt.
Free-motion quilting is an excellent technique for adding texture. Practicing on scrap fabric before stitching onto your actual quilt helps build confidence and precision. This technique works beautifully on the lionβs mane.
Binding is the final step that frames your Lion Quilt β Quilt Pattern. Choosing a binding color that complements the overall palette ties the entire design together. Carefully sewn binding ensures long-lasting edges.
After completion, washing and drying your quilt according to fabric care instructions maintains its softness and longevity. Proper care preserves the beauty of your Lion Quilt for years to come.
